SHINee (샤이니, debuted 2008). Stage names are what fans know; the birth names below are what their parents chose — and, for the Korean members, what the hanja characters mean.
| Stage name | Birth name | What the given name means | Birthday · day element | Name carries |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Onew | 이진기 李珍基 · Jin-Ki | 진 珍 · precious기 基 · foundation | 1989-12-14 戊申 · ⛰️ 土 Earth | 金 Metal, 土 Earth |
| Key | 김기범 金起範 · Ki-Bum | 기 起 · to rise범 範 · model, example | 1991-09-23 丙申 · 🔥 火 Fire | 土 Earth, 木 Wood |
| Minho | 최민호 崔珉豪 · Min-Ho name page → | 민 珉 · fine jade호 豪 · heroic | 1991-12-09 癸丑 · 💧 水 Water | 金 Metal, 水 Water |
| Taemin | 이태민 李泰民 · Tae-Min name page → | 태 泰 · great, peaceful민 民 · people | 1993-07-18 庚子 · ✨ 金 Metal | 水 Water, 火 Fire |
Hanja spellings as published in Korean-language profiles and press; where we could not confirm one we say so rather than guess. Birth dates as publicly listed. The day-element reading follows traditional naming practice (작명) and is offered for cultural interest.
Every Korean has a day element from their birth date (the “day pillar” in a 사주 chart). In naming practice, parents often choose hanja whose element balances or feeds the child's own.
